What happens when fuel starts burning
Stored energy inside is released and changed to other forms of energy like heat and light
What does fuel need to set them alight
Heat
What does fuel need to keep them burning
Oxygen and heat
What happens if any of elements are not there in a fire triangle
The fire will be extinguished
How does a candle snuffer work
A candle snuffer smothers the flame by preventing oxygen from reaching it. It then extinguishes the flame
What happens when you blow a candle
Your breath moves heat from the burning gas. If there is no heat, the fire will extinguish.
What happens when you put water on a fire
Water will take away the heat from the fire and thus extinguish the fire.
What must fire fighter do with a fire
- Remove all fuel from the fire
- Remove heat so that the fuel will stop burning
- They must smother the fire by preventing oxygen getting to the fuel.
